WebThe plate tectonics theory states that Earth’s crust is broken into plates that move. The interaction of plate movements results in earthquakes, volcanoes, mountain building and separation of continents. WebBy the 1960s, the theories of continental drift and sea floor spreading were supported by reliable scientific data and combined to develop modern‐day plate tectonic theory. WebFeb 12, 2024 · A tectonic plate is a massive, irregularly-shaped slab of solid rock usually composed of both continental and oceanic lithosphere. Every continent is a part of a plate, and many experts have proposed that these continental plates keep moving resulting in the movement of the continents.
